Breaking News: Stickup artist robs Phuket bank
Chutharat Plerin

post-249866-0-41557300-1456486421_thumb.

PHUKET: -- Police are scrambling to track down an armed bank robber who made off with an estimated 400,000 baht cash from a Phuket bank this afternoon.

The masked man walked into the Krungthai Bank branch on Sakdidet Road in Phuket Town, drawing his gun and demanding cashiers hand over all easily accessible cash.

"We are currently checking CCTV footage and taking all necessary actions to ensure the suspect is arrested," said Phuket Provincial Police Deputy Commander Pinit Sirichai.
